Sathya Sai Baba Critical But Stable


Puttaparthi (Andhra Pradesh), April 7 (IANS) Spiritual leader Sathya Sai Baba's condition continues to be critical but stable, doctors attending on him said Thursday.

According to the medical bulletin issued by Sathya Sai Super Speciality Hospital, his condition remained unchanged.

Hospital director A.N. Safaya said Sathya Sai Baba continued to be on ventilator to help in respiratory function. His pulse rate and blood pressure level are normal.

The duration of dialysis has also been reduced, indicating improvement in his kidney function. He continued to be on continuous renal replacement therapy for the last four days.

The doctors had Wednesday said 85-year-old Sathya Sai Baba was suffering from multi-organ dysfunction but was responding to the treatment.

Satyha Sai Baba, who has millions of devotees both in India and abroad, was admitted to the hospital March 28 with pneumonia and breathing problems.

The doctors implanted a pacemaker to regulate his heart beat.
